Decimal to Octal
Decimal to Octal
When you convert a decimal number to octal, you're fundamentally shifting from base 10 to base 8, which can seem straightforward but hides a few nuances. You'll find that the process involves dividing by 8 and tracking remainders, but have you considered why octal is important in certain computing contexts? Understanding this conversion isn't just about numbers; it's about grasping the broader implications for data representation in digital systems. As you explore further, you'll uncover some common pitfalls and practical applications that illustrate its significance.
Understanding Number Systems
Understanding number systems is essential for converting between different bases, like decimal and octal. When you grasp the concept of number systems, you'll find it easier to work with various numerical representations. Each number system has a unique base, which defines how many digits you use. For instance, the decimal system is base 10, utilizing digits from 0 to 9, while the octal system operates in base 8, employing digits from 0 to 7.
In converting from decimal to octal, using a Decimal to Octal converter can simplify the process considerably. Recognizing this distinction helps you appreciate how numbers are represented differently across systems. Each digit's position in a number carries a specific value based on its base. In decimal, the rightmost digit represents \(10^0\), the next \(10^1\), and so forth. This principle also applies when you switch to octal—each position represents \(8^n\) instead.
Once you understand how these systems function, converting between them becomes more manageable. You'll develop a sense of how to interpret and translate values accurately. With practice, you'll find that the intricacies of number systems become second nature, making tasks like converting decimal numbers to octal a straightforward process.
What Is Decimal?
What exactly is the decimal system? You probably use it every day without even thinking about it. The decimal system, or base-10, is the most common numeral system. It uses ten digits: 0, 1, 2, 3, 4, 5, 6, 7, 8, and 9. Each digit's position in a number determines its value. For instance, in the number 345, the 3 represents three hundreds, the 4 represents four tens, and the 5 represents five ones.
You can see how this positional value works by considering how you count. When you go from 9 to 10, you reset to 0 and add 1 to the next position, moving from units to tens. This base structure allows you to express any number, no matter how large, using just a combination of these ten digits.
Essentially, the decimal system is intuitively simple but incredibly powerful, making it easy to perform arithmetic calculations.
It's essential for daily activities like shopping, budgeting, and measuring time, cementing its role as the foundational numbering system in most cultures globally.
What Is Octal?
The octal numeral system, or base-8, uses just eight digits: 0, 1, 2, 3, 4, 5, 6, and 7. Unlike the decimal system, which is base-10 and incorporates two additional digits (8 and 9), octal simplifies counting by limiting the range of digits. This makes it easier to represent binary data in a more compact form.
You might find octal particularly useful in computing, as it's closely related to binary. Every octal digit corresponds to a group of three binary digits, allowing a straightforward way to convert between the two systems. This connection is one reason why programmers and computer scientists often work with octal numbers.
In everyday situations, you probably won't encounter octal as frequently as decimal, but it plays a significant role in certain programming languages and systems. For example, in Unix file permissions, octal representations indicate read, write, and execute permissions for users, groups, and others, which can be a key aspect of managing files.
Understanding octal can give you a valuable perspective on how various numerical systems interrelate, particularly in the digital landscape.
Conversion Methods
Converting decimal numbers to octal can be straightforward once you grasp the basic methods. The most common technique involves repeated division by 8. You take your decimal number and divide it by 8, recording the quotient and the remainder. The remainder represents the least significant digit in the octal number. You repeat this process with the quotient until it equals zero.
Another method, especially useful for smaller numbers, is called the direct conversion method. This involves grouping your decimal number's binary equivalent into sets of three (since 2^3 equals 8). Once you've formed these groups, you convert each set directly to its octal equivalent.
You can also use a calculator or programming tools to simplify the process. Most calculators have a built-in function to switch from decimal to octal, saving you time and reducing the chance of errors.
No matter which method you choose, practicing your conversions will solidify your understanding. Soon, you'll feel confident converting decimal numbers to octal in no time!
Step-by-Step Conversion Example
To demonstrate the conversion of a decimal number to octal, let's take a concrete example: converting the decimal number 65.
Start by dividing 65 by 8, the base for octal. When you divide, you get 8 with a remainder of 1. This remainder represents the least significant digit, or the rightmost digit, in the octal number.
Next, take the quotient, which is 8, and divide it by 8 again. This time, you get 1 with a remainder of 0. This remainder becomes the next digit to the left in the octal representation.
Proceed by dividing the quotient, 1, by 8 once more. Now, you get 0 with a remainder of 1.
Now that there's no more quotient left to divide, it's time to compile the remainders. You started with the last remainder obtained (1), followed by the second (0), and finally the first (1).
So, reading from the last remainder to the first, the octal equivalent of the decimal number 65 is 101.
There you go; converting decimal to octal is straightforward when you follow the steps!
Practical Applications of Octal
Octal numbering systems find practical applications in various fields, particularly in computing and digital electronics. When you work with computer systems, you might encounter octal as a way to simplify binary representation. Since each octal digit corresponds to three binary digits, it makes it easier to read and write large binary numbers.
In programming, especially with older computer systems or embedded programming, octal representation can simplify addressing memory locations. You'll often see it used in Unix file permissions, where permissions are set using octal codes to define read, write, and execute rights succinctly.
Additionally, digital circuit design sometimes employs octal systems for its compactness. When you're working on microcontrollers or embedded systems, octal can help in reducing the complexity of wiring and coding.
Even in networking, certain protocols utilize octal representations to streamline configurations. Understanding how and where to use octal effectively can save you time and prevent confusion.
Common Mistakes to Avoid
When dealing with octal numbering, it's easy to make mistakes that can lead to confusion and errors in your work. One of the most common pitfalls is forgetting that octal only uses digits from 0 to 7. If you accidentally include an 8 or a 9, your calculations will be incorrect, and you'll be left puzzled.
Another frequent mistake involves the conversion process. Make sure you're dividing the decimal number by 8 correctly. Keep track of your remainders, as they represent the octal digits in reverse order. Skipping a step or misplacing a digit can throw everything off.
Additionally, pay attention to how you write your octal numbers. It's best practice to prefix them with a zero (0) to indicate it's an octal number, helping you avoid mixing it up with decimal values.
Lastly, don't forget to practice regularly. The more you engage with octal conversions, the more comfortable you'll become, helping you steer clear of these common errors.
Conclusion
In the dance of numbers, converting from decimal to octal isn't just a task; it's like revealing a secret door to a new dimension. By mastering this simple method, you're not only expanding your numerical toolkit but also stepping confidently into the world of computing. So, embrace the beauty of base 8 and let your numeral skills shine. Each conversion brings you closer to becoming a true wizard of numbers, casting spells with every calculation you perform!